2019 Kenneth M. Smith Scholarship Application

APPLY TODAY! Since 2009, the Kenneth M. Smith Scholarship Fund has awarded 154 scholarships. One hundred and twenty-four scholarships were for $1,000 and thirty-two were for $2,000 for a total of $188,000 in scholarships for JAG graduates.
